For baking the sponge cakes, I recommend using a 20 cm diameter pan to achieve the ideal cake layer thickness. You can decorate this cake with cream, chocolate, chocolate shavings, or cake crumbs—everything works! Optionally, add some nuts to the cream for an incredibly delicious result. Instructions
- 1
Step 1

1. Mix the sifted flour with sugar, cocoa, baking powder, and baking soda. Brew strong coffee and let it cool. Add eggs, kefir, coffee, and vegetable oil to the dry ingredients, then mix with a blender for one minute.
- 2
Step 2

2. Line the pan with parchment paper, divide the dough into three equal parts, and bake three layers in a preheated oven at 170 degrees (30 minutes each).
- 3
Step 3

3. Leave the cakes in the mold for 5 minutes, then remove them. Allow the cakes to cool, trim off the tops, and crumble them. For the cream, melt the dark chocolate in the microwave, then let it cool to room temperature.
- 4
Step 4

4. Beat the soft butter and room-temperature chocolate paste with a mixer for several minutes. Add the warm chocolate and mix at low speed until smooth.
- 5
Step 5

5. Spread the cream between the cake layers, on the sides, and on top. Coat the sides with crumbs from the cake tops. Decorate the cake with the remaining cream and refrigerate for 6–8 hours.
